BF09 DSX is a 2009 Mercedes-benz Sprinter in White with a 2,148c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 18 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 61.1%.
Across all 2009 Mercedes-benz Sprinter models, the average MOT pass rate is 71.7% with a typical mileage of 142,212 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Mercedes-benz Sprinter f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 175,127 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BF09 DSX,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Mercedes-benz Sprinter typically stays on UK roads for around 30 years. At 17 years old, this Mercedes-benz Sprinter is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
